“…In view of this ability, explorations of oleaginous/biodiesel plants (plants that are traditionally used to produce biodiesel) for the recovery of oleaginous endophytes have gained essence ( Strobel et al, 2001 ; Peng and Chen, 2007 ; Strobel et al, 2008 ; Dey et al, 2011 ). For example, biodiesel plants, such as, Jatropha curcas , Pongamia pinnata , Sapindus mukorossi , Mesua ferrea , Terminalia bellerica , Cascabela thevetia , and Ricinus communis proved competent sources for unveiling oleaginous endophytic fungi ( Paul et al, 2020 ). Among the procured oleaginous fungi, the lipid content of Lasiodiplodia exigua SPSRJ27, Phomopsis sp.…”
